@charset "utf-8";
/* CSS Document */


.bgtop {background-image:url(../images/profile_users.jpg);}

.btn-group {margin-top:5px !important;}


.text01 {color:#E5E4E2;
margin-top:52px;
text-align:right;
font-style:italic;
 }



.text02 {color: rgba(0,0,0,0.6);
    text-shadow: 2px 2px 3px rgba(255,255,255,0.1); }

.head {border-bottom:2px #99041A solid;
-webkit-box-shadow: 0 10px 6px -6px #7d0011;
       -moz-box-shadow: 0 10px 6px -6px #7d0011;
            box-shadow: 0 10px 6px -6px #7d0011;}

.box {
background: rgba(76,76,76,0.74);
background: -moz-linear-gradient(left, rgba(76,76,76,0.74) 0%, rgba(89,89,89,0.64) 100%);
background: -webkit-gradient(left top, right top, color-stop(0%, rgba(76,76,76,0.74)), color-stop(100%, rgba(89,89,89,0.64)));
background: -webkit-linear-gradient(left, rgba(76,76,76,0.74) 0%, rgba(89,89,89,0.64) 100%);
background: -o-linear-gradient(left, rgba(76,76,76,0.74) 0%, rgba(89,89,89,0.64) 100%);
background: -ms-linear-gradient(left, rgba(76,76,76,0.74) 0%, rgba(89,89,89,0.64) 100%);
background: linear-gradient(to right, rgba(76,76,76,0.74) 0%, rgba(89,89,89,0.64) 100%);
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#4c4c4c', endColorstr='#595959', GradientType=1 );
padding:15px;
border:8px #333 solid;}

.box02 {background-color:#E5E4E2;
padding:15px;
border:8px #9A051B solid;}


.text1 {color:#FFF;}

.text2 {
margin-top:5px;}

.box2 {padding-bottom:35px;}

.text3 {text-align:justify;}

.one {background-image:url(../images/gray_pattern.gif);}

.text5 {color:#A0081D;}



/* CLIENT CAROUSEL STYLES */
.clients-carousel {
    margin-top: 50px; /*SMALL TOP MARGIN FOR SPACE */
    padding: 0 30px 30px 30px;
}

    .clients-carousel .thumbnail {
        border: 1px solid #FF4D98;
    }

    .clients-carousel .carousel-control.left {
        height: 30px;
        width: 25px;
        margin-top: 58px;
        background: #F00;
        left: -15px;
    }

    .clients-carousel .carousel-control.right {
        height: 30px;
        width: 25px;
        margin-top: 58px;
        background: #F00;
        right: -15px;
    }

    .clients-carousel img {
        width: 100%;
        height: 120px;
    }



.two {background-image: url(../images/gray_pattern.gif);
border-top:5px #CCCCCC double;
}




.footer {background-color:#333;
border-top:8px #9A051B solid;}

.text6 {color:#FFF;}

.text7 {text-align:justify;
color:#FFF;}

.text7 a {color:#000;}

.text7 a:hover {text-decoration:none;}

.text8 a {color:#fff;}

.text8 a:hover {text-decoration:none;
color:#fff;}

.text9 {color:#000;}

.box3 {border:2px #A0081D solid;
padding:5px;
border-radius:4px 4px 0 0;}



@media (max-width: 600px) {
  .text01 {margin-top:0px !important;}
   
   .btn-group {margin-top:8px !important;}
   
   .box2 {padding-bottom:0px !important;}
   
   
}

.text11 {text-shadow: -1px -1px white, 1px 1px #333;
color:#980015;

    
}




/*--user css--*/


.top {background-color:#F6F6F6;
padding-top:5px;}

.text12 a {color:#333;}

.text12 a:hover {color:#980319;
text-decoration:none;}

.text13 {color:#980319;}

.text14 a  {background-image:url(../images/img00.png);
width:100%;}

.usertwo {background-color:#CCCCCC;}

.box4 {background-color:#E6E7E8;
padding:8px;
border-radius:5px;
border:1px #980116 solid;}

.text15 {font-size:18px;
color:#960117;}

.left {float:left;}


.text16 {color:#999;}

.media {border-top:1px #999 solid;
padding-top:5px;}

.box5 {  background: #ebebeb none repeat scroll 0 0;
  border-radius: 3px;
  color: #646464;
  font-size: 14px;
  margin: 0;
  padding: 5px 10px 5px 12px;
  width: 100%;
   float: left;
  padding: 30px 15px 0 25px;
  width: 60%;
   display: inline-block;
  width: 6%;
  display: inline-block;
  padding: 0 0 0 10px;
  vertical-align: top;
  width: 92%;
  color: #747474;
  display: block;
  font-size: 12px;
  margin: 8px 0 0;
  
 
}
.type{
    
    width:380px;
height:40px;
border-radius: 10px;
border-color:#05728F;

}



.box101 {
   
   background: #05728f none repeat scroll 0 0;
  border-radius: 3px;
  font-size: 14px;
  margin: 0; color:#fff;
  padding: 5px 10px 5px 12px;
  width:100%;
  float: right;
  width: 46%;
  color: #747474;
  display: block;
  font-size: 12px;
  margin: 8px 0 0;
  display: inline-block;
  width: 6%;
  display: inline-block;
  padding: 0 0 0 10px;
  vertical-align: top;
  width: 92%;
  
  
}


.box100 {padding:8px;
border-radius:15px;
border:1px #980116 solid;
  
}
.box102 {padding:8px;
border-radius:15px;
border:1px #980116 solid;
  
}

.thumbnail1 {background-color: #fff;
    border: 1px solid #9d051a;
    border-radius: 4px;
      display: block;
  
    line-height: 1.42857;
    margin-bottom:0;
    padding: 4px;
    transition: all 0.2s ease-in-out 0s;}
    
    .text23 {background-color:#F5F5F5;
position: relative;
padding:4px;

border:1px #999999 solid;
 text-align:center;

    
}
.text23 a:hover {text-decoration:none;}

.text17 {color:#980015;
    
    font-size:10px;
}
.text101{color:#ffffff;}

.text18 a {color:#980319;}

.text18 a:hover {text-decoration:none;
color:#980319;}

.text19 {font-size:16px;
color:#999;
font-style:italic;
margin-top:8px;}

.text20 {color:#930419; font-size:15px;}

.text21 {color:#333; font-size:18px;}

.text22 {color:#999; font-size:16px;}





.box6 {border:1px #CCCCCC solid;
padding:5px;
margin-bottom:5px;
margin-top:10px;
    height:200px;
}

.box7 {background-color:#713C44;
padding:10px;}

.text24 {background-color:#FFF;
padding:5px;
text-align:center;
margin-top:8px;
font-size:20px;}


.text25 {color:#FFF;
font-size:20px;
margin-top:-50px;}


.friendbox {background-color:#980421;}

.text26 {color:#FFF;
margin-top:8px;
text-align:center;}


.box8 {border:1px #CCCCCC solid;
padding:5px;
margin-bottom:5px;
margin-top:10px;
background-color:#c4b2b4;}



.box9 {border:1px #CCCCCC solid;
padding:5px;
margin-bottom:5px;
margin-top:10px;
background-color:#e8d8da;}



.text27 {text-shadow: -1px -1px white, 1px 1px #333;
color:#980015;
border-bottom:1px #CCCCCC solid;
padding-bottom:5px;}

.text28 {color:#9E071C;}

.text29 {color:#999;}

.text30 {color:#9A051B;
border-bottom:1px #999999 dotted;
padding-bottom:5px;
font-size:18px;}

.text31 {
border-bottom:1px #999999 dotted;
padding-bottom:5px;}
.demo_changer{ 
    z-index: 900; 
    position: fixed;
    left: -750px;
    top: 80px; 
}

.demo_changer .dropdown-menu > li > a:hover, .dropdown-menu > li > a:focus {
	background:#fff;
}

.demo_changer select:active,
.demo_changer select:focus,
.demo_changer select:hover,
.demo_changer .button:active,
.demo_changer .button:focus,
.demo_changer .button:hover,
.demo_changer .btn:active,
.demo_changer .btn:focus,
.demo_changer .btn:hover,
.demo_changer .button:active,
.demo_changer .button:focus,
.demo_changer .button:hover {
	box-shadow:none !important;
}
.demo_changer .button {
    -moz-user-select: none;
    background-image: none;
    border: 1px solid #ddd;
    border-radius: 3px;
    cursor: pointer;
    display: inline-block;
    font-size: 14px;
    font-weight: normal;
	background:#fff;
    line-height: 1.42857;
    margin-bottom: 0;
	width:160px !important;
    padding: 6px 12px;
    text-align: center;
    vertical-align: middle;
    white-space: nowrap;
}
.demo_changer .img-thumbnail {
    height: 35px;
    margin-bottom: 5px;
    width: 48.5% !important;
    padding: 3px;
}
.demo_changer img {
    margin: 2.4px !important;
    width:100% !important;
    
}

.demo_changer h4 {
	padding-bottom:0;
}
.demo_changer i {color:#fff;font-size:21px;}

.demo_changer .btn{ 
	margin-top:10px;
}
.demo_changer .demo-icon{
    cursor: pointer;
	text-align:center;
    float: right;
    height: 37px;
	line-height:40px;
	-webkit-border-radius:0 16px 16px 0;
	-moz-border-radius:0 16px 16px 0;
	border-radius:0 16px 16px 0;
    width: 40px;
}

#demo-icon{
    cursor: pointer;
    text-align:center;
    float: right;
    height: 37px;
	line-height:40px;
	-webkit-border-radius:0 16px 16px 0;
	-moz-border-radius:0 16px 16px 0;
	border-radius:0 16px 16px 0;
    width: 40px;
}
.demo_changer .demo-icon:after {
	
	}
.demo_changer .form_holder {
	/* Permalink - use to edit and share this gradient: http://colorzilla.com/gradient-editor/#fceabb+0,fccd4d+50,f8b500+51,fbdf93+100;Orange+3D+%235 */
background: #fceabb; /* Old browsers */
background: -moz-linear-gradient(top, #fceabb 0%, #fccd4d 50%, #f8b500 51%, #fbdf93 100%); /* FF3.6-15 */
background: -webkit-linear-gradient(top, #fceabb 0%,#fccd4d 50%,#f8b500 51%,#fbdf93 100%); /* Chrome10-25,Safari5.1-6 */
background: linear-gradient(to bottom, #fceabb 0%,#fccd4d 50%,#f8b500 51%,#fbdf93 100%); /* W3C, IE10+, FF16+, Chrome26+, Opera12+, Safari7+ */
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#fceabb', endColorstr='#fbdf93',GradientType=0 ); /* IE6-9 */
    float: right;
	padding:5px;
    width: 750px;
	border:1px solid #024618;
}

.demo_changer .form_holder p{
    font-size: 12px;
}

.demo_changer .form_holder input{
    width: 55px;
	border-radius: 0 10px 10px 0;
	box-shadow: none;
}
.color_display_2 {
   clear: both;
   color: #FFFFFF;
   display: inline-block;
   font-size: 12px;
   width:31px !important;
    height:31px;
    margin-bottom: 7px;
    padding: 4px 10px;
    text-align: center;
    text-shadow: 0 -1px 0 rgba(0, 0, 0, 0.3);
    text-transform: uppercase;
	box-shadow: 0 1px 0 rgba(255, 255, 255, 0.3) inset, 0 0 2px rgba(255, 255, 255, 0.3) inset, 0 1px 2px rgba(0, 0, 0, 0.29);
}

.color_display_2 a{
    color: #fff;
    text-decoration: none;
}

.color_display_2 a:focus,
.color_display_2 a:hover {
    color: #ededed !important;
    text-decoration: none;
}


.predefined_styles{
    padding:0 5px;
}


.demo_changer .btn {
	width:165px !important;
}


@media only screen and (max-width: 1024px) {
.demo_changer{
   /* display: none;*/
}
}



